About Bronx Regional High School
Bronx Regional High School is a public high school in Bronx, NY, part of NEW YORK CITY GEOGRAPHIC DISTRICT #12. Bronx Regional High School serves approximately 117 students, and covers grades 10th-12th, and has a 9:1 student-teacher ratio. Bronx Regional High School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.3 out of 10 and ranks #3,291 of 4,742 schools in NY.
Structured state assessment records for Bronx Regional High School show 58%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2021) and 60%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2021).

What Parents Should Know
At 117 students, Bronx Regional High School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.
At 9:1 students to teachers, Bronx Regional High School sits well below the national average. Smaller classes like that usually mean more one-on-one time between students and teachers.
